OpenAI's New Micro Keypad Signals a Hardware Shift, But Coders Aren't Convinced

OpenAI has entered the hardware market with Micro, a specialized keypad designed to pair with ChatGPT and its coding tool Codex, though initial reception from the developer community has been lukewarm at best. The device, developed in collaboration with specialty keyboard maker Work Louder, costs $230 and features six customizable "agent" keys that can be programmed to execute specific tasks within ChatGPT, along with six command keys for controlling those programs.

The Micro keypad represents OpenAI's first foray into hardware, arriving amid legal turbulence. Apple sued OpenAI several weeks ago, accusing the company of trade theft, and reports have surfaced about another smart home device in development at OpenAI that was allegedly built by former Apple engineers. These developments underscore the stakes of OpenAI's hardware ambitions, even as the Micro itself remains a niche product.

What Makes the Micro Different From a Regular Keyboard?

The Micro keypad is built around a specific workflow: it allows users to assign different ChatGPT sessions or projects to individual keys, enabling quick toggling between multiple projects without navigating through browser tabs or windows. The device connects via Bluetooth or USB cable and includes a voice dictation button that lets users simply speak their requests aloud, then tap "send" to submit them. The keys are color-coded to provide visual feedback: white indicates an idle agent, blue means the AI is thinking, green signals task completion, and red flags an error.

Users can customize the Micro entirely within ChatGPT itself through a dedicated Micro tab, adjusting everything from key brightness to the specific commands and projects tied to each key. For power users who juggle multiple ChatGPT sessions daily, this setup can streamline workflow by eliminating the need to manually switch between different conversations or tools.

How to Get the Most Out of the Micro Keypad

  • Assign Specific Projects: Map different ChatGPT sessions or Codex coding projects to individual agent keys so you can instantly jump between them without searching through your browser history or application windows.
  • Leverage Voice Dictation: Use the dedicated dictation button to speak your requests aloud rather than typing, which can speed up iteration cycles when working with AI coding assistants or content generation tasks.
  • Memorize Color Codes: Learn what each key color means (idle, thinking, complete, error) so you can quickly assess the status of your AI agents without looking at your screen.
  • Customize Brightness: Adjust the key lighting in the Micro settings to match your workspace lighting and reduce eye strain during long coding sessions.

Why Are Developers Skeptical About the $230 Price Tag?

Despite its thoughtful design, the Micro has faced significant pushback from its intended audience. Reviews on Reddit have been largely negative, with one user calling it "a prank and not a real product," while others argued that serious coders will not adopt it. An independent tech outlet, Aftermath, published a particularly critical review titled "OpenAI's expensive macropad feels engineered to piss me off specifically," arguing that the $230 price tag is difficult to justify when cheaper DIY and off-the-shelf alternatives exist.

The core tension is practical: developers already know how to use their computer's mouse and keyboard efficiently. The Micro requires a learning curve to program and operate, and the value proposition hinges entirely on how much time a user spends in ChatGPT daily. For casual users or even moderate AI tool users, the investment may not pay off.

A TechCrunch reviewer who tested the device found that once the initial setup was complete, the Micro did offer genuine convenience. The ability to toggle between projects with a single keystroke and use voice dictation made the workflow "considerably more efficient and enjoyable." However, the reviewer acknowledged that the learning curve and the question of whether the device is functionally easier than a standard keyboard remain legitimate concerns.

What Does This Mean for OpenAI's Hardware Strategy?

The Micro keypad is just the beginning of OpenAI's hardware ambitions. The company is reportedly developing a smart home device to pair with ChatGPT, though details remain scarce. The legal battle with Apple will likely shape how aggressively OpenAI can pursue these hardware initiatives, and whether the company can differentiate its devices in a crowded market.

For now, the Micro serves as a test case: it appeals to a narrow slice of the market, specifically ChatGPT power users who value hardware aesthetics and are willing to invest time in customization. The device's sturdy build quality and Apple-coded packaging suggest OpenAI is serious about hardware design, but the mixed reception from developers indicates that specialized hardware alone may not be enough to drive adoption without a compelling reason to abandon existing tools.

Whether the Micro becomes a cult favorite among coders or remains a niche novelty will depend largely on how OpenAI refines the product based on early feedback and whether the company can lower the barrier to entry for less technical users. For now, it remains a device engineered for a specific audience, and that audience is still deciding whether it is worth the price.
